What Even Are These Magical Floors, Anyway

You see, we’re talking about a super cool process that basically takes your existing concrete — whether it’s in your garage, basement, or even a commercial spot — and makes it incredible. This involves a whole lot of specialized grinding, kinda like super intense sanding, to smooth out any bumps or roughness. Then, after that, we apply special hardeners that make the concrete even stronger than it was before.

Next up, it’s all about the polishing stage, where we use finer and finer grinding tools to bring out an amazing sheen, from a subtle satiny glow to a mirror-like shine. This lets you pick the exact level of reflectivity that fits your personal style and the mood of your space. Now, some folks worry these floors might be super slippery, especially if they’re really shiny, but modern techniques largely handle this concern. We can actually add special treatments that increase the grip without taking away from the amazing visual effect. Therefore, you can have both that sleek look and peace of mind about walking around.

Also, a lot of people ask if they’re cold, which is a fair question, especially in Nebraska winters. Interestingly, concrete is a pretty good thermal mass, meaning it absorbs and slowly releases warmth, which can help stabilize indoor temps. This means they aren’t necessarily colder than other hard surfaces and can even complement underfloor heating systems wonderfully.

Polished concrete is the existing slab itself, mechanically refined through a series of diamond-grinding passes from coarse (40 grit) to fine (3000 grit), with a densifier and stain guard applied at the right stage.

Concrete grinder polishing a slab

The result is the original slab transformed into a hard, dense, reflective surface that reads as polished stone. There is no coating sitting on top, so there is nothing that can chip, peel or hot-tire fail. The slab is the floor.

The grinding and polishing process

Polished concrete mirror detail
  1. Phone quote.Square footage, slab age, target gloss, color. Most quotes firm after one call.
  2. Grind and expose.Heavy diamond grinders cut at 40 grit. Installers in Hazard and the surrounding area repair joints and cracks in matching color.
  3. Densify and stain.Lithium silicate densifier penetrates and hardens. Optional acid stain or water-based dye. Stain guard final treatment.
  4. Polish.Progressive grit passes 200, 400, 800, 1500, up to 3000. Gloss locked at target meter reading. Photo handover.

How much does polished concrete cost in Hazard, Nebraska?

Standard cream-polish residential and light-duty runs $4 to $7 per square foot. Showroom mirror-grade with aggregate exposure and dye is $7 to $12 per square foot. Warehouse-scale (10,000+ sq ft) drops to $3 to $5 range. Quoted firm after the call.

How is this different from epoxy?

Epoxy is a coating that sits on top of the slab. Polished concrete is the slab itself, ground and densified. Epoxy can chip, peel, hot-tire pickup. Polished concrete cannot, there is no coating to fail.

How long does the install take?

Residential rooms run two to three days. larger floors 5,000 to 20,000 sq ft run a week to two weeks. The space is dust-controlled with wet grinding and HEPA vacuum.
